From real experience

When choosing between El Nido and Coron: Coron is generally considered less vibrant for nightlife and dining options compared to El Nido.
The ferry journey between them takes approximately 5 hours and can be rough. While Coron offers diving opportunities to wrecks, they are often heavily overgrown. El Nido provides active nightlife with numerous bars and restaurants (e.g., SAVA Beach Bar, Amigos bar, Gorgonzola Pizza & Pasta, The Reggae Island, La Salangane Hotel Bar and Restaurant) and a walkable town center. It is well-suited for island-hopping tours (Tours C and A are popular) and beach activities, with life continuing after sunset. For transportation within El Nido's center, walking is feasible, and tricycles are readily available for excursions.

Transportation from Manila airport: Grab is a reliable option, with payments possibly made in cash.
The cost can vary, e.g., 208 PHP to Pasay. Pre-booked transfers are available via Booking.com and Trip.com, with prices around 1122 PHP to the city center. Some hotels offer complimentary shuttle services. Free Wi-Fi is usually available at the airport for a limited time (e.g., 3 hours).

Travelers arriving at night in Manila can utilize the Runway Manila skybridge, which connects the airport to nearby residential areas and accommodation options like Airbnb.
Self-check-in apartments are available. Police presence near the airport enhances security. For those preferring direct transport, taxis are readily available.

Upon arrival at the airport in the Philippines, travelers have several transportation options: taking a bus, finding a local driver, or arranging a transfer directly at the airport exit where many drivers offer services.
It is also possible to find contacts for verified local drivers for pre-arranged transfers.

In Moalboal, finding affordable taxis is challenging due to high tuk-tuk prices and limited availability of ride-sharing services like Grab outside the city limits.
Local taxis also tend to operate within town. Booking tours or transportation through local Facebook groups might be a more economical option.

Recommended transport booking platforms for the Philippines: 1. 12Go Asia (international aggregator for buses/ferries).
2. BookTickets.ph (internal routes, payments via GCash/Maya). 3. Sakay.ph (detailed public transport/commuter instructions). 4. Moovit (best for city navigation in Manila, Cebu, Davao).

Bolt taxi services might not be available on Panglao.
However, tricycles (tuk-tuks) are readily available and can transport passengers to most locations on the island for approximately 150 PHP.
